Household Income in Fen Street ONS 2023
The average total household income in Fen Street is approximately £51,762 a year before tax, 6% below the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£37,614.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Fen Street ONS 2025
There are approximately 1,108 active businesses based in Fen Street, around 45 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 89%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 20 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Fen Street
Of the 11,012 households in and around Fen Street, 70% are owned, 13% are socially rented and 16%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Fen Street.
